Output dd1053106c7f816552a156959a2cce7a8e27127c59644a58d19ed6705969b984:13
- value
- 18517000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e9bc334d6adb7b2cbc109cb245675ed17421d91 OP_EQUAL
- address
- 332FyoKGJ2d8zkhSy5xqcBUzZT4zeKdiEe
- transaction
- dd1053106c7f816552a156959a2cce7a8e27127c59644a58d19ed6705969b984